What Are Hydraulic V-Ring Seals?

A V-ring seal is an elastomeric sealing component designed to create a reliable sealing interface between mating components. Its flexible rubber structure allows it to maintain contact with the sealing surface while accommodating certain movement and dimensional changes.

In hydraulic and industrial equipment, effective sealing helps prevent fluid leakage and protects internal components from contaminants.

A suitable V-ring seal can help reduce:

· Hydraulic fluid leakage

· Contamination from dust or moisture

· Unplanned equipment maintenance

· Component wear

· Pressure loss

· Production downtime

The actual performance depends on the seal material, operating conditions, installation dimensions, and equipment design.

Material Selection Is Critical

The material used in a V-ring seal directly affects its resistance to temperature, fluids, chemicals, and mechanical stress.

NBR

NBR, also known as nitrile rubber, is widely used for applications involving petroleum-based oils and fuels.

Its advantages include:

· Good oil resistance

· Good wear resistance

· Reliable mechanical properties

· Suitable performance for many hydraulic applications

NBR is often a practical choice for general hydraulic equipment where extreme temperature or chemical resistance is not the primary concern.

EPDM

EPDM provides strong resistance to water, weathering, ozone, and certain chemicals.

It can be considered for applications involving:

· Water

· Hot water

· Steam

· Outdoor environments

· Selected chemical media

However, EPDM is generally not the preferred material for applications involving petroleum-based oils or fuels, so fluid compatibility should be confirmed before selection.

Silicone

Silicone provides excellent flexibility across a broad temperature range. It can maintain useful elastic properties in applications involving significant temperature fluctuations.

Typical advantages include:

· Good low-temperature flexibility

· High-temperature capability

· Stable elasticity

· Good resistance to environmental aging

Silicone may be suitable for applications where temperature variation is more important than resistance to petroleum-based fluids.

FKM

FKM, commonly associated with Viton® materials, is known for its resistance to heat, oils, fuels, and many chemicals.

It is often selected for more demanding industrial environments where NBR or other general-purpose elastomers may not provide sufficient temperature or chemical resistance.

FKM can be particularly useful for equipment exposed to elevated temperatures and aggressive fluids.

FFKM

FFKM is a high-performance elastomer intended for severe chemical and thermal environments.

It provides excellent resistance to a broad range of aggressive chemicals and can maintain sealing properties under demanding conditions.

For specialized equipment where chemical compatibility is a major concern, FFKM offers an advanced sealing material option.

Temperature Range: -60°C to +320°C

The available material range supports applications from approximately -60°C to +320°C, but this should not be interpreted as one universal operating range for every seal.

Each elastomer has its own recommended temperature limits.

For example, the appropriate choice depends on whether the application involves:

· Continuous high temperatures

· Short-term temperature peaks

· Very low temperatures

· Rapid temperature changes

· Contact with heated fluids

Manufacturers should evaluate the actual operating temperature rather than selecting a material based solely on its maximum published temperature.

Hardness Options from 20–90 Shore A

Seal hardness can influence installation, deformation resistance, flexibility, and sealing contact.

In practical applications, softer materials can provide better conformity to certain surfaces, while harder compounds may offer improved resistance to deformation under suitable conditions.

The ideal hardness depends on:

· Operating pressure

· Groove design

· Sealing gap

· Surface finish

· Temperature

· Dynamic movement

· Material properties

Selecting hardness together with the seal geometry and equipment design is therefore more reliable than choosing hardness independently.

Industrial Applications

Hydraulic V-ring seals can be used in a wide range of industrial and commercial equipment.

Hydraulic Equipment

Hydraulic cylinders, power units, valves, pumps, and related systems require dependable sealing to control hydraulic fluids and maintain system performance.

NBR is commonly considered for general oil-based hydraulic environments, while FKM may be selected for applications involving higher temperatures or more demanding fluid conditions.

Automotive Equipment

Automotive systems contain numerous fluid-handling and mechanical components where elastomeric seals are required.

Material selection should be based on the specific fluid, temperature, and mechanical environment.

Pumps and Valves

Pumps and valves may handle water, oils, fuels, chemicals, or other fluids. Selecting a compatible elastomer is essential to prevent premature seal deterioration.

Industrial Machinery

Manufacturing equipment often operates continuously, making seal reliability important for reducing unplanned maintenance and downtime.

Chemical Processing Equipment

Where aggressive chemicals are involved, FKM or FFKM may be considered depending on the specific chemical medium, concentration, temperature, and operating conditions.

Fluid Handling Systems

Water and other fluid systems can benefit from EPDM or other compatible elastomers when their chemical and temperature requirements match the application.

How to Choose the Right Hydraulic V-Ring Seal

Selecting a seal should begin with the operating environment rather than the seal size alone.

Step 1: Identify the Fluid

Determine exactly what the seal will contact, including hydraulic oil, fuel, water, steam, or chemicals.

Step 2: Confirm Temperature

Record the normal operating temperature as well as possible temperature peaks and low-temperature conditions.

Step 3: Check Pressure and Movement

Operating pressure, dynamic movement, and sealing gaps can influence material hardness and seal design.

Step 4: Confirm Dimensions

Provide the required dimensions, groove information, or technical drawings.

Step 5: Select the Elastomer

Choose NBR, EPDM, Silicone, FKM, or FFKM based on actual chemical and temperature requirements.

Step 6: Confirm Applicable Standards

For standard products, AS568, ISO 3601, and JIS B 2401 can help simplify dimensional selection. Customized sizes are available when standard specifications are unsuitable.
